Commit Graph

  • 76ba39d60b Add regex whitelist to pylint Stefano Rivera 2010-12-27 13:39:43 +02:00
  • ce3c2f6bee test_update_maintainer.py: Use mox. Benjamin Drung 2010-12-27 01:51:19 +01:00
  • 8b659d8fc3 Drop non-default values from pylint.conf Stefano Rivera 2010-12-27 02:00:25 +02:00
  • 2fa20670c3 test_update_maintainer.py: Unpatch os.path.isfile after test. Benjamin Drung 2010-12-27 00:33:49 +01:00
  • d199de5185 Add add-patch to edit-patch manpage Stefano Rivera 2010-12-26 22:05:40 +02:00
  • 0fa022c367 Run pylint on Python source code. Stefano Rivera 2010-12-26 21:57:44 +02:00
  • 58559d9db8 Help silence pylint Stefano Rivera 2010-12-26 21:56:05 +02:00
  • e47794030f Small error pylint spotted Stefano Rivera 2010-12-26 21:55:15 +02:00
  • 657a57d266 suspicious-source: Whitelist Python source code. Stefano Rivera 2010-12-26 20:32:48 +02:00
  • 6348bc3df1 Install add-patch link and use it in sponsor-patch. Benjamin Drung 2010-12-26 15:16:33 +01:00
  • 1ef75a1a23 Install additional files via setup.py instead of debian/*. Benjamin Drung 2010-12-26 15:14:35 +01:00
  • d7ee0af9f7 Implement testcases for update-maintainer. Benjamin Drung 2010-12-26 01:35:22 +01:00
  • 2e9a5c3db6 Fix some errors found by pylint. Benjamin Drung 2010-12-26 01:01:57 +01:00
  • 425b9da534 ubuntutools/sponsor_patch/main.py: Disable some pylint error. Benjamin Drung 2010-12-26 00:52:24 +01:00
  • c8e71cacee builder.py: Pass ARCH to pbuilder too. Benjamin Drung 2010-12-25 20:05:38 +01:00
  • 3f3018aef2 update-maintainer: Rewrite completely using python-debian (LP: #666504). Benjamin Drung 2010-12-25 19:49:49 +01:00
  • 00faea17e2 Remove devscripts checks (we Depend on it). Reword python-simplejson error Stefano Rivera 2010-12-25 18:31:00 +02:00
  • b5274624ac Suggest python-simplejson | python (>= 2.7) and complain if they are missing in pull-debian-debdiff Stefano Rivera 2010-12-25 18:06:18 +02:00
  • 18d02c4c39 Make pull-debian-source exit 0 on help, so tests pass again. Stefano Rivera 2010-12-25 18:05:12 +02:00
  • e39a3565e5 check-symbols: List all required tools. Benjamin Drung 2010-12-25 16:47:09 +01:00
  • 8ebee7e0f2 pull-lp-source: Make pylint a little bit happier. Benjamin Drung 2010-12-25 16:32:29 +01:00
  • 9f340a7562 * pull-debian-debdiff: Rewrite in Python, and use snapshot.debian.org. * pull-lp-source: Support -d (LP: #681699) Stefano Rivera 2010-12-25 16:26:43 +01:00
  • df1ae06d30 builder.py: Mark some functions as private. Benjamin Drung 2010-12-25 15:32:55 +01:00
  • 53faae58dc Mirror support in backportpackage Stefano Rivera 2010-12-24 16:22:21 +02:00
  • 85f8548d5f Typo Stefano Rivera 2010-12-24 16:22:12 +02:00
  • 1054307414 control.py: Add required methods for update-maintainer. Benjamin Drung 2010-12-24 13:38:59 +01:00
  • 5182d62de1 if...else precedence in dget calls Stefano Rivera 2010-12-24 13:47:22 +02:00
  • 0a64cae0da Use keyword args when getting series Stefano Rivera 2010-12-24 13:47:02 +02:00
  • 86e940a9ae pull-lp-source: Support -d (LP: #681699) Stefano Rivera 2010-12-24 12:16:34 +02:00
  • 9033bf7ee7 Tidy pull-lp-source, use Logger Stefano Rivera 2010-12-24 12:04:46 +02:00
  • 0d51908f40 Add mirror support to pull-lp-source Stefano Rivera 2010-12-24 12:00:03 +02:00
  • 088341fa7c snapshot: Don't re-download existing files if hashes match Stefano Rivera 2010-12-24 11:17:25 +02:00
  • 3354374972 Actually --no-fallback makes no sense for these scripts, although we probably want it for test-builders Stefano Rivera 2010-12-24 11:08:55 +02:00
  • 40aa623ac3 Update copyright Stefano Rivera 2010-12-24 03:43:01 +02:00
  • 8e27317b65 Rename mirror variables, add Ubuntu Stefano Rivera 2010-12-24 03:04:42 +02:00
  • cf68c75fa8 - Support this in many u-d-t scripts, and update manpages. - Deprecate old configuration environment variables. * pull-debian-debdiff: Rewrite in Python, and use snapshot.debian.org. Stefano Rivera 2010-12-24 02:58:54 +02:00
  • 30b6628910 Config file support for pull-debian-debdiff Stefano Rivera 2010-12-24 01:07:48 +02:00
  • e9b90a8650 Minor tweaks to pull-debian-source Stefano Rivera 2010-12-24 00:19:27 +02:00
  • d5c7de285e Configurable mirror support for pull-debian-source Stefano Rivera 2010-12-23 23:12:24 +02:00
  • c28ddf5698 Wrap all long lines in ubuntutools. Benjamin Drung 2010-12-23 20:42:21 +01:00
  • fec33a6a41 wrap-and-sort: Split Control into separate Python file. Benjamin Drung 2010-12-23 17:18:42 +01:00
  • 401dd27276 pythno-gnupginterface Depends -> Recommends Stefano Rivera 2010-12-23 17:38:30 +02:00
  • f822b7c1d9 wrap-and-sort: Make documentation consistent with backportpackage. Benjamin Drung 2010-12-23 16:01:22 +01:00
  • 0fe7076e88 lp-set-dup: Make pylint a little bit happier. Benjamin Drung 2010-12-23 12:30:29 +01:00
  • e0457ff333 massfile: Add option parsing and various fixes. Benjamin Drung 2010-12-23 12:18:30 +01:00
  • 2279efb2cf massfile: Fix wrong variable name and make pylint a little bit happier. Benjamin Drung 2010-12-23 12:17:20 +01:00
  • 121bc50341 massfile: Add missing comma. Benjamin Drung 2010-12-23 12:08:02 +01:00
  • 86b7ff977c Add option parsing to massfile, for lpinstance, correct manpage's view on file locations Stefano Rivera 2010-12-23 12:35:41 +02:00
  • 2de4aecc4f lp-set-dup: Config file support Stefano Rivera 2010-12-22 23:58:16 +01:00
  • b18aa6209a syncpackage: Make pylint a little bit happier. Benjamin Drung 2010-12-22 23:53:09 +01:00
  • 2a2cd83b74 sponsor-patch: Make pylint a little bit happier. Benjamin Drung 2010-12-22 23:31:35 +01:00
  • 8351e6876d wrap-and-sort: Make pylint a little bit happier. Benjamin Drung 2010-12-22 23:04:57 +01:00
  • 9fa9f3eb96 Whitespace and style cleanups Stefano Rivera 2010-12-23 00:01:39 +02:00
  • 3f694feb94 suspicious-source: Make pylint a little bit happier. Benjamin Drung 2010-12-22 22:43:21 +01:00
  • d0ed0d83cc Broke ubuntu-build in lat commit. Add missing indent Stefano Rivera 2010-12-22 23:06:03 +02:00
  • f01beda01c Convert last Python code from mixed tabs and spaces to spaces Stefano Rivera 2010-12-22 23:04:29 +02:00
  • 63f418c534 Config file for import-bug-from-debian. Stefano Rivera 2010-12-22 21:59:24 +01:00
  • cce5ceb0ec Correct variable name Stefano Rivera 2010-12-22 22:57:02 +02:00
  • e5ac5620d7 Correct variable name Stefano Rivera 2010-12-22 22:56:39 +02:00
  • f6335cf993 ack-sync: Convert to PEP8. Benjamin Drung 2010-12-22 21:40:23 +01:00
  • 30df1c0ec8 - Support this in many u-d-t scripts, and update manpages. - Deprecate old configuration environment variables. Stefano Rivera 2010-12-22 21:33:58 +01:00
  • fe2aa64ea9 Improve synopsis markup Stefano Rivera 2010-12-22 22:23:53 +02:00
  • dc6b404bc9 lp-set-dup: Config file support Stefano Rivera 2010-12-22 22:22:05 +02:00
  • 8cee545568 Migrate to ubuntutools.logger Stefano Rivera 2010-12-22 21:24:35 +02:00
  • b94d134650 Add warning() and substitution support to logger Stefano Rivera 2010-12-22 21:04:53 +02:00
  • bcf9772206 edit-patch: Don't let cat error through if debian/source/format doesn't exist. Stefano Rivera 2010-12-22 20:53:38 +02:00
  • 43ec3ff136 Depend on python-gnupginterface (used by dgetlp). Benjamin Drung 2010-12-22 19:18:32 +01:00
  • b2b0375646 Add most dependencies to Build-Depends for successfully run the tests. Benjamin Drung 2010-12-22 19:15:31 +01:00
  • 517bc10e3b - Test for that every script can run --help and return 0. - 404main, merge-changelog, pull-debian-debdiff, pull-debian-source, pull-revu-source: + Return 0 after showing help. Stefano Rivera 2010-12-22 19:08:20 +01:00
  • c6a82f8bc1 merge-changelog: Return non-zero when arguments don't parse. Stefano Rivera 2010-12-22 19:48:50 +02:00
  • f74f07507b 404main: Return non-zero when arguments don't parse. Stefano Rivera 2010-12-22 19:36:58 +02:00
  • 48c30e91a6 404main: Fix indentation. Benjamin Drung 2010-12-22 18:35:41 +01:00
  • 54c0a88464 sponsor-patch: Remove needless new-line from print command. Benjamin Drung 2010-12-22 18:35:11 +01:00
  • 34b1991bdd Fix pull-revu-source help, and return 0 Stefano Rivera 2010-12-22 17:14:48 +02:00
  • df6b32086b Close /dev/null Stefano Rivera 2010-12-22 17:09:29 +02:00
  • 4c0a650052 Blacklist get-build-deps Stefano Rivera 2010-12-22 17:03:01 +02:00
  • f55ab3d465 Provide pid when killing Stefano Rivera 2010-12-22 17:01:55 +02:00
  • 96d72d83e2 signals don't use underscores Stefano Rivera 2010-12-22 16:57:25 +02:00
  • 9ba4809eed Reverted: r876: Append a1 to version number in pre-releases Stefano Rivera 2010-12-22 16:56:05 +02:00
  • c4de897e2a 404main, merge-changelog, pull-debian-debdiff, pull-debian-source: Return 0 after showing help. Stefano Rivera 2010-12-22 16:53:58 +02:00
  • af2497291f add "add-patch" that provides the non-interactive version of edit-patch Michael Vogt 2010-12-22 15:44:22 +01:00
  • 8756577518 Complete blacklist Stefano Rivera 2010-12-22 16:28:36 +02:00
  • 8e30fddfae sponsor-patch: Catch KeyboardInterrupt. Benjamin Drung 2010-12-22 14:32:24 +01:00
  • 71a1bffba5 Recommend bzr-builddeb (used by sponsor-patch for branches). Benjamin Drung 2010-12-22 14:23:28 +01:00
  • 715c554e88 Fix: The package was only uploaded if the target was "ubuntu". Benjamin Drung 2010-12-22 14:19:21 +01:00
  • b4a245b281 Append a1 to version number in pre-releases Stefano Rivera 2010-12-22 15:07:19 +02:00
  • 3ac706401f Test for that every script can run --help and return 0. Stefano Rivera 2010-12-22 15:05:55 +02:00
  • 9077c0babd Close already fixed bug. Benjamin Drung 2010-12-22 12:54:08 +01:00
  • 51966025d6 debian/changelog: Use capital LP for closing a bug. Benjamin Drung 2010-12-22 01:44:24 +01:00
  • 493597a500 Convert tabs to spaces in Python scripts (PEP-8) part 1. Benjamin Drung 2010-12-22 01:28:00 +01:00
  • 2c2aaf90b3 Migrate to logging Stefano Rivera 2010-12-22 02:09:04 +02:00
  • 0a35d3d13d sponsor-patch: Fix crash if uploading to ubuntu without building the package before. Benjamin Drung 2010-12-22 00:52:45 +01:00
  • d264ee7e97 sponsor-patch: Fix indentation of Logger change. Benjamin Drung 2010-12-21 23:29:50 +01:00
  • 0184a10c21 Prefix replacement in warning Stefano Rivera 2010-12-22 00:14:28 +02:00
  • b46114c20f Move up mailserver config parsing, so we return deprecation errors fast Stefano Rivera 2010-12-22 00:11:10 +02:00
  • c43e9775e0 - Support this in many u-d-t scripts, and update manpages. - Deprecate old configuration environment variables. Stefano Rivera 2010-12-22 00:07:48 +02:00
  • 9ee1a8faa0 sponsor-patch: Fix 'str' object has no attribute 'startwith' crash caused by a typo. Benjamin Drung 2010-12-21 22:50:02 +01:00
  • bd08a0c423 Config file for import-bug-from-debian Stefano Rivera 2010-12-21 23:41:55 +02:00
  • ff84b6da91 sponsor-patch: Use "bzr builddeb" instead of the shortcut "bzr bd". Benjamin Drung 2010-12-21 22:41:53 +01:00
  • 67ad32a06d Making debian/copyright a little bit shorter. Benjamin Drung 2010-12-21 22:15:54 +01:00